Chickasaw Nation Announces election results

Release Date: Tuesday, July 29, 2008

By Tony Choate, Media Relations Specialist
Chickasaw Nation Media Relations Office

Chickasaw Nation Election Secretary Rita Loder announced the results of the tribal election today.

Katie Case, Ada, won election to Pontotoc District Seat 3, while a runoff election will be required for Pickens District Seat 2.

Case received 1,616 votes (51%), while Nancy Elliott received 1,559 votes (49%) for the Pontotoc District seat.

Incumbent Donna Hartman will face Connie Barker in a runoff election for the Pickens District seat.

Hartman received 901 votes (45%), while Barker received 729 votes (37%).

Charles Lewis finished third, with 361 votes (18%).

The run-off election between Hartman and Barker will be August 26.

Incumbent legislators Dean McManus, Ada, and Steven Woods, Sulphur, were unchallenged.

Sitting Chickasaw Nation Supreme Court Justice Cheri L. Bellefeuille Gordon, Sulphur, was also unchallenged.

Elected officials will take the oath of office 11 a.m. Monday, Oct. 1.
